Cut sheet metal quickly, safely & easily.

CaNibble Professional Nibbler has been 40 years in the making and comes from the original manufacturer of attachment Nibblers. It's the only nibbler available with a patented cutting action which is why it cuts so well.

CaNibble is proudly made in Australia using the finest manufacturing methods and materials, it's guaranteed for 5 years and we back each and every one we make.

All you need is a power drill with a 0.354" (9mm) chuck capacity capable of 1500-3000 RPM's, and your CaNibble is ready for action.

Specifications:

• Cuts sheet material up to 0.079" thick (for brass, aluminium, formica and plastics) 0.063" for mild steel and 0.039" for stainless steel

• Radiuses as tight as 0.315" (5/16")

• Leaves a 0.157" wide cut path

• Rate of cutting = 5 ft/minute at 3000 rpm

Materials CaNibble Cuts:

Flat sheet material, corrugated material, pipes, profiles - like gutters. Stainless steel, copper, mild steel, aluminium, Formica, Plastic sheet, fibreglass, denim, leather, even paper and card.

We recommend a separate punch and die be kept for stainless steel and for aluminium. Always lubricate the path of the cut.
